A resolution honoring the 150th anniversary of the American Printing House for the Blind.
Introduced: January 23, 2008

Plain-English summary
(This measure has not been amended since it was introduced. The summary of that version is repeated here.)
Honors the 150th anniversary of the establishment of the American Printing House for the Blind in Louisville, Kentucky.
